Former North Dakota gubernatorial candidate expresses "disgust" and calls Mund "tainted" after Haugen's departure from congressional race

(Fargo, ND) -- Cara Mund, the independent candidate for North Dakota's lone congressional seat is taking criticism from a former candidate for governor.

Dr. Shelley Lenz made comments while denouncing what she calls the move by the Democratic NPL to force Mark Haugen out of the race, in order to bolster support for Mund.

"I don't know if she was involved in it. Either she was naive or involved. I'm not sure but I do feel like that move by the Democratic NPL tainted her," said Lenz. 

Lenz contends the party supports Mund because she is pro-choice, while Haugen is pro-life.

"I was pretty sad. It was more than sad. I was really kind of disgusted that it appears to be somebody that is not even here in North Dakota in previous leadership kind of forced him out for a shiny new object," said Lenz. 

Lenz was the Democratic-NPL candidate for governor in 2020.

Mund has not accepted our requests for an interview to this point.
